(11-11-2018 11:36 AM)BlazinBham Wrote:  You know the point of this thread. No need to discuss. Just a tracker for those of us who are paranoid af.

Fired:
David Beaty at Kansas, Nov 4th
Bobby Petrino at Louisville, Nov 11th
Mike Jinks at Bowling Green, Oct. 14th
DJ Durkin at Maryland, Oct 31
Mike MacIntyre at Colorado, Nov 18
Everett Withers at Texas State, Nov 18
Brad Lambert at Charlotte, Nov 18
Mark Whipple at UMass, Nov 20
Larry Fedora at UNC, nov 25
Kliff Kingsbury at Texas Tech, Nov 24
Mike Sanford at WKU, Nov 25
John Bonamego at Central Michigan, Nov 23
Paul Johnson at Georgia Tech, Nov 28

Hired:
Les Miles at Kansas
Mack Brown at UNC
Tyson Helton at WKU
Scot Loeffler at Bowling Green
Mike Houston at Charlotte
Jake Spavital at Texas State

Updated

Still worry about GT, but otherwise this thread is just for fun now.
